Output fc80d7b00b91dc7ff9e9fdfb6b84e377d0c169d3fb7e1bfad85163751132d4ac:5

value
12089888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aef689c0395445591cf3cdb93c42693e614c6ae6 OP_EQUAL
address
3He8qgv3rio2fC6GhEqvDB15dNRZ56p7eu
transaction
fc80d7b00b91dc7ff9e9fdfb6b84e377d0c169d3fb7e1bfad85163751132d4ac
spent
true